On Page 3 of the ADSM V2R1 Performance Tuning Guide (section
entitled "Communication Protocols), the following statements are made:
"On MVS the major performance distinction is that TCP/IP runs as a
single task on a single central processor (CP). ..... In addition, the
ADSM MVS server is also restricted to a single CP, but has
multi-tasking capabilities."
Could someone elaborate on the MVS server's architecture and
whether or not any multi-processing is possible? What about migrating
data from one copy group to the next vs. normal backup activity?
